Veterans Transitional Housing

Veterans transitional housing offers shelter, recovery services for chemical dependency

Catholic Charities operates two transitional houses for veterans in partnership with the St. Cloud HRA and the St. Cloud Veteran's Administration Hospital Chemical Dependency Program. Each four-bedroom house accommodates four residents who share communal living space.

The HRA owns the homes and leases them to Catholic Charities which accepts direct referral of recovering chemically dependent veterans from the Veterans Administration Hospital Chemical Dependency Unit. Catholic Charities provides enhanced housing management services focusing on future reintegration into the community through housing, ongoing employment, and networking with appropriate local resources.

Program requirements

  • Four months of sobriety prior to entry into the program
  • Continued connection with V.A. chemical dependency aftercare resources
  • Employment
  • Maintenance of home through yard work, snow removal, and all housekeeping duties
  • Payment of monthly fee for service

Referrals

Referrals are made to the program by the VA Medical Center.
